Photos from Montreal photographer and community worker Scott Weinstein,
who has traveled to Palestine to work with the Palestinian Red Crescent
Society as a registered nurse. This photo essay documents the contemporary
realities of Israeli colonialism and occupation in the West Bank,
specifically focusing on the realities of settler violence against
Palestinian civilians in the West Bank, specifically in the Palestinian
city of Hebron.
As documented by numerous Israeli human rights organizations, such as
B'Tselem, Israeli settlers have beaten Palestinian civilians and forced
many Palestinians to leave the historic city center in Hebron,
traditionally an important and vibrant Palestinian market in the West
Bank.
